Dracaena care. Dracaena. Botanical name: Dracaena. Common name: Dragon tree. This popular and widely available houseplant is prized for its resilient, easy-going nature and tropical good looks. It produces rosettes of long, narrow, glossy leaves from the top of a woody stem that gets taller as the plant matures. Large plants make a fine focal point in a room.

Dracaena ‘Janet Craig’ Care . Dracaena ‘Janet Craig’ plants need well-draining, loose soil to grow well. They tolerate low light and grow best in filtered or medium indirect light. Water heavily when the top 3 inches of soil dry out. Ideal temperature range is 65- 90°F (18-32°C). They do not have any particular humidity needs.

Dracaena marginata – Dragon Tree: An In-depth Look. Dracaena marginata features a slim, upright growth habit, with leaves growing up to 2 feet long (60 cm). The leaves are dark green with characteristic red or purple margins, adding a splash of color to indoor spaces. Native: This species is native to Madagascar, where it thrives in a range ...

Aug 13, 2023 · To care for Dracaena marginata, provide well-draining soil and bright indirect light. Water weekly to by-weekly once the top 2-3 inches of soil are dry (5-7.5cm). Provide a temperature between 60 to 80 degrees Fahrenheit (16 to 27 Celsius). The ideal humidity is 60-80%. To care for Dracaena Trifasciata, plant it in a pot with a well-draining sandy or cactus mixture. Provide bright filtered sunlight. Water once a month from below when the top 2 inches of soil is dry (5 cm). The temperature should be between 70-90°F (21-32°C). 40% humidity is optimal.Dracaena draco, the botanical name for Dragon tree, is a plant, native to the Canary Islands but can also be found in places like western Morocco and Cape Verde.It is thought to have originated from the Azores archipelago.
